fix amount check

This commit is contained in:
spen 2015-02-11 16:13:31 +08:00
parent dcb507659d
commit 5fd33b62f8
1 changed files with 4 additions and 4 deletions

View File

@ -55,20 +55,20 @@ class NkuhtDonatesController < ApplicationController
@nkuht_donate.donation_serial_number = NkuhtDonateMain.get_serial_number
@nkuht_donate.donation_payment_number = NkuhtDonateMain.get_payment_number
if @nkuht_donate.donation_amount < '1'
if @nkuht_donate.donation_amount.to_i < 1
@notice = []
@notice << t('nkuht_donate.donation_amount_err')
redirect_to "#{params[:referer_url]}", :notice => @notice
elsif @nkuht_donate.donation_way == '2' and @nkuht_donate.donation_amount > '30000'
elsif @nkuht_donate.donation_way == '2' and @nkuht_donate.donation_amount.to_i > 30000
@notice = []
@notice << t('nkuht_donate.donation_amount_atm')
redirect_to "#{params[:referer_url]}", :notice => @notice
elsif @nkuht_donate.donation_way == '3' and @nkuht_donate.donation_amount > '20000'
elsif @nkuht_donate.donation_way == '3' and @nkuht_donate.donation_amount.to_i > 20000
@notice = []
@notice << t('nkuht_donate.donation_amount_market')